A Look Back at Lindsay Lohan's Most Iconic Movies

Lindsay Lohan burst onto the scene as a talented youngster actor in the late 20th century, quickly becoming a household figure.

Her early roles showcased her range as an actress, solidifying her position as one of Hollywood's prominent talents.

One within her most iconic films is "Mean Girls," a high school comedy that remains a classic. Lohan's portrayal of Cady Heron, a naive teenager navigating the treacherous landscape of high school cliques, is both hilarious and touching.

Another popular film in Lohan's filmography is "Freaky Friday," a joyful body-swap film where she stars alongside Jamie Lee Curtis. Their chemistry brings humor to the screen as they exchange bodies and navigate each other's perspectives.

Lindsay Lohan has left an lasting mark on Hollywood with her brilliance and iconic roles.

Her contributions to cinema continue to be celebrated, forming her a true star.

From Red Carpet Rebel

Lindsay Lohan's fashion sense has undergone a dramatic evolution over the years. In her early career, she was known for bold, eye-catching outfits that often pushed boundaries and embraced trends with a youthful, sometimes rebellious flair. Think low-rise jeans, crop tops, sparkle, and plenty of platform shoes. As she developed, her style changed to reflect a more refined aesthetic.

She embraced minimalist silhouettes, classic items, and a more neutral color palette. Today, Lohan's style is characterized by clean lines, timeless looks, and a sense of effortless poise. It's a far cry from the party girl persona she once cultivated, showcasing her growth and maturity both on and off the red carpet.
